The Facts:
HC Bobby Petrino said that Harrington would remain as the team's starting QB for Monday night's game against the New York Giants at the Georgia Dome. "It's in our best interest and gives us our best chance to succeed to stay with Joey," Petrino said Monday. "He understands our offense. He knows what we want to do, what we want to execute."

Fantasy Football Diehards Line:
Petrino replaced Harrington with Byron Leftwich early in the fourth quarter of Atlanta's 20-13 loss at Tennessee Sunday. "He took a lot of hits and toward the end of the third quarter, I didn't think he was completing passes that he normally completes," Petrino said. "Making the change might provide a spark for us and get us something going. I think it was the right thing to do." Leftwich, signed three weeks ago, has been promoted to the No. 2 quarterback ahead of Chris Redman, Petrino said.
